    The show starred Jonny Lee Miller in the title role of attorney Eli Stone. In the first episode, Stone is discovered to have an inoperable brain aneurysm which is causing hallucinations. His acupuncturist, Dr. Chen, suggests that his hallucinations are actually divinely inspired visions of the future. These visions often foreshadowed future cases and events, including an impending earthquake.

    Eli Stone is an American television comedy-drama created by Greg Berlanti and Marc Guggenheim, who also served as executive producers alongside Ken Olin who directed the pilot, with Melissa Berman producing.

    Characters
    Jonny Lee Miller - Eli Stone (Young Eli is played by Justin Lieberman)
    Eli Stone is a successful attorney in San Francisco who is diagnosed with an inoperable brain aneurysm which is causing hallucinations. The hallucinations cause Eli to become alienated by his peers and soon his life takes a detour. Despite the fact that he is not religious, he takes his hallucinations as signs, helping people in accepting lawsuits in hopes of bettering their lives.

    Natasha Henstridge - Taylor Wethersby
    Taylor Wethersby is Eli's ex-fiance who is also an attorney. She formerly works in another company, and later joins in Eli's firm after they broke up. Although taken aback by Eli's episodes of hallucinations, she is determined to help him at any means. She is the daughter of Jordan Wethersby, the head of Wethersby, Posner & Klein.

    Loretta Devine - Patti Dellacroix
    Patti is Eli's helpful and sassy assistant. She considers Eli as a dear friend of hers and she is always blatantly honest to Eli.

    Matt Letscher - Dr. Nathan Stone
    Nathan is Eli's caring elder brother who is a doctor. He is the first who discovered Eli's conditions and he is also skeptical about his visions. Nathan dated Beth, a girl who Eli lost his virginity to in college after Eli introduced each other at his engagement party.

    Sam Jaeger - Matt Dowd
    Matt is Eli's co-worker and rival in the law firm. He is described as sarcastic, arrogant and having a frat-boy personality.

    James Saito - Dr. Chen
    Dr. Chen is an acupuncturist who explains Eli's conditions as a prophetical message. He helps Eli to analyze the visions Eli has and advises Eli to pursue them. He studied acupuncture in Beijing as well as holistic medicine. It is revealed that he is not a Chinese immigrant, and the "Dr. Chen" is merely an act so he will be taken seriously because, "No one trusts an acupuncturist from New Jersey". He once worked for Eli's father, who told him once that he would repay a favor by helping his son (Eli) someday.

    Julie Gonzalo - Maggie Dekker
    Maggie is a junior attorney who is ambitious and enthusiastic to her work. Much to Eli's dismay, she often assists him in his cases in hopes of moving up the career ladder. She is considered a religious person who is the first person to believe in Eli's visions without hesitations. She was engaged to Scott, who is in Eli's visions of the earthquake.

    Jason George - Keith Bennett
    Keith is a criminal law attorney who sued an employer for racism. After Keith lost the lawsuit, Jordan hired him as he saw Keith's potential.

    Victor Garber - Jordan Wethersby
    Jordan is the co-owner of the firm and Taylor's father. He is often skeptical of Eli's imaginations. However, He is a father figure to Eli and represented Eli when Eli is prosecuted for ineligibility to perform his work.
